U.S., Ukraine Agree on New 19-Point Peace Plan…

Ukraine_US_Talks_on_Peace_Plan
ParlerGabTruth Social

by Ronny Reyes at New York Post

A new version of a peace plan hammered out on between senior Washington and Kyiv delegations is proving more palatable to Ukrainians — and would remove several provisions that were previously described by US officials as “maximalist demands” by Moscow.

The new plan — said to include about 19 points — would nix one of the most controversial provisions of the 28-point plan reported last week — that Ukraine would have to give up territory in the Donbas that Russia has been unable to conquer in more than 11 years of war there, The Post can reveal.

Instead, the issue of territorial claims will be left to President Trump and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ky to hammer out at a later date, according to two people familiar with the discussions.

Secretary of State Marco Rubio, US special envoy Steve Witkoff, US Secretary of the Army Daniel Driscoll and Jared Kushner meeting with Ukrainian officials at the the US Mission in Geneva on Nov. 23, 2025.4
Secretary of State Marco Rubio, US special envoy Steve Witkoff, US Secretary of the Army Daniel Driscoll and Jared Kushner meeting with Ukrainian officials at the the US Mission in Geneva on Nov. 23, 2025. Photo by Fabrice COFFRINI / AFP via Getty Images

It would also get rid of another sticking point in which Ukraine would have had to promise never to join NATO — a goal Russian dictator Vladimir Putin has sought before invading the country in 2022.

Still, Zelensky in a Monday afternoon post to X said the new plan is not yet finalized.

“Now the list of necessary steps to end the war can become doable,” he wrote. “As of now, after Geneva, there are fewer points — no longer 28 — and many of the right elements have been taken into account in this framework.

“There is still work for all of us to do together to finalize the document, and we must do everything with dignity.”

JOINT STATEMENT ON UNITED STATES-UKRAINE MEETING

by The White House

On 23 November 2025, representatives of the United States and Ukraine met in Geneva for discussions on the U.S. peace proposal. The talks were constructive, focused, and respectful, underscoring the shared commitment to achieving a just and lasting peace.

Both sides agreed the consultations were highly productive. The discussions showed meaningful progress toward aligning positions and identifying clear next steps. They reaffirmed that any future agreement must fully uphold Ukraine’s sovereignty and deliver a sustainable and just peace. As a result of the discussions, the parties drafted an updated and refined peace framework.

The Ukrainian delegation reaffirmed its gratitude for the steadfast commitment of the United States and, personally, President Donald J. Trump for their tireless efforts aimed at ending the war and the loss of life.

Ukraine and the United States agreed to continue intensive work on joint proposals in the coming days. They will also remain in close contact with their European partners as the process advances.

Final decisions under this framework will be made by the Presidents of Ukraine and the United States.

Both sides reiterated their readiness to continue working together to secure a peace that ensures Ukraine’s security, stability, and reconstruction.
